Abstract
The utility model discloses a ditching and seed sowing device for cane seedlings, which comprises a plow standard (1), wherein a left plow wall (21) and a right plow wall (22) extending backwards are arranged in the rear direction of the plow standard (1), a left aileron (31) and a right aileron (32) are respectively arranged on the outer sides of the left plow wall (21) and the right plow wall (22), a fertilizing area (16) is formed in at the front part between the left plow wall (21) and the right plow wall (22), a sowing area (17) is formed at the front part, a double-row cane feeding bucket (6), a seed cutting device (5) and a double-row seed guiding groove (4) are arranged in sequence above the left plow wall (21) and the right plow wall (22) from the top down, the outlet of the double-row cane feeding bucket (6) is connected to the inlet of the seed cutting device (5), the outlet of the seed cutting device (5) is connected to the inlet of the upper end of the double-row seed guiding groove (4), and the outlet at the lower end of the double-row seed guiding groove (4) is connected to the sowing area (17). The ditching and seed sowing device for cane seedlings, provided by the utility model, has a compact structure, is high in work efficiency, excellent in performance, and reliable in work, and can greatly alleviate the labor intensity of workers.

Embodiment
Be described in further detail below in conjunction with the embodiment of accompanying drawing the utility model.
To shown in Figure 6, the described cane seedling trench digging of the utility model seeding unit comprises plow standard 1 like Fig. 1, and plow standard 1 rear is provided with the left mouldboard 21 and right mouldboard 22 that extends back, and described left mouldboard 21 is the wedge shape form with right mouldboard 22 and prolongs along central axis backward.The outside at left mouldboard 21 and right mouldboard 22 is respectively equipped with port aileron 31 and starboard aileron 32, and wherein said port aileron 31, starboard aileron 32 are hinged with left mouldboard 21, right mouldboard 22 respectively.Leading portion between this left side mouldboard 21 and the right mouldboard 22 forms fertilization area 16, and leading portion forms sowing division 17.Plow standard 1, left mouldboard 21 and right mouldboard 22 form plough; The main plantation ditch that plays a part out; Form sowing division and fertilization area during trench digging respectively, realize that seed manure gives, can avoid fertilizer directly to contact causing the generation of " burning kind " phenomenon with sugarcane kind 7; Make seedling line up the duplicate rows shape, avoid occurring seedling and overlap to form and built on stilts make seedling not reach soil and necrosis.
Above described left mouldboard 21 and right mouldboard 22, be provided with double sugarcane bucket 6, cutting implement 5, the double seed guiding groove 4 of feeding from top to bottom successively.Double outlet of feeding sugarcane bucket 6 is connected to the inlet of cutting implement 5, and the outlet of cutting implement 5 is connected to the inlet of double seed guiding groove 4 upper ends, and the outlet of double seed guiding groove 4 lower ends is connected to sowing division 17.Described cutting implement 5 comprises cuts kind of case 18, cuts to be provided with drive roll 11 and driven roll 8 in kind of the case 18, cuts kind of case 18 outer being provided with and drives the hydraulic motor 14 that drive roll 11 rotates, and hydraulic motor 14 is connected with drive roll 11 through connector 13.Described drive roll 11 is provided with driving gear 12, and driven roll 8 is provided with the driven gear 15 that is meshed with driving gear 12, passes through meshed transmission gear between drive roll 11 and the driven roll 8.Said drive roll 11 radially is provided with blade 10 with driven roll 8 peripheries, and described drive roll 11 is provided with axial sebific duct 9 with driven roll 8 peripheries, and described sebific duct 9 is many, is evenly distributed on the outer peripheral face of drive roll 11 and driven roll 8.Described double seed guiding groove 4 is deep-slotted chip breaker or straight shape groove (according to the agriculture requirement apolegamy when the area), and double seed guiding groove 4 also can be according to when the agriculture requirement in area single seed guiding groove being installed.
When the utility model uses; Operator is sent into sugarcane and is cut kind of case 18 from double hello sugarcane bucket 6; Under the drive of hydraulic motor 14; Cut drive roll 11 and driven roll 8 in kind of the case 18 and rely on the pair of engaged gears reverse rotation of cylinder axle heads, be fixed on drive roll 11 and grasp sugarcane with sebific duct 9 on the driven roll 8 and down carry, then the sugarcane stem is cut off by the blade of cutting kind of usefulness 10 of correspondence.Cut sugarcane kind 7 glides along double seed guiding groove 4, is emitted in the plantation ditch of being left by plough straightly, accomplishes kind of the seeding process of cutting.
